Extending stripes on spoiler...

I have a chance to buy a factory set of rally stripes for a really good price. I was wondering if anyone has used the trunk stripes to wrap the stripes over the top and partially down the rear of the spoiler. I didnt know if everything would line up right...

I don't think the trunk stripes are long enough to do that. When I pulled off the stock spoiler I saw that the trunk stripes went all the way down the deck lid under the spoiler, meaning there must be extensions in the kit to stripe the spoiler. On my dovetail I had a local vinyl shop add the stripes, but they don't continue over the top.
